Hi - I am folowing the nipple confusion controversy with
great interest. Perhaps the air is different in Israel but
I see nipple confusion. I work in hospital and I have
babies that have nursed well the first day, were given a
bottle during the night for what ever reason, and the next
day we spent alot of time sweating, getting this baby back
on. When I check the suck the baby is most often bunching
his tongue and popping the breast out.....or not opening
wide enough. I have a lot of experience with latching and
with some babies I feel that the bottle has changed their
sucking pattern. I am willing to be convinced because it
is certainly easier to use a bottle when supplementing is
a must......but my experience tells me otherwise (in some
babies). Please keep discussing this - how do others feel?
